Output 2bf9f3724384e5df281096d2aa4fd76082db5695c813b67e1d49c1864fd42cdc:6

value
1866382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89b31463fbf3bf203b1a5d3e2669ce83dc3c40a8 OP_EQUAL
address
3EF72VmRr1F251QbPv8W8rkPoiWJqqDUmH
transaction
2bf9f3724384e5df281096d2aa4fd76082db5695c813b67e1d49c1864fd42cdc
confirmations
302597
spent
true